Easy AIP Lemon Vinaigrette
Ingredients:
¼ cup olive oil
2 TBS lemon juice (about 1 lemon)
Zest from 1 lemon
½ tsp stone ground mustard (AIP Reintro – Stage 1)
¼ tsp salt
¼ tsp black pepper (AIP Reintro – Stage 1)
Directions:
Combine all ingredients in a small bowl and whisk until fully combined. You can also shake together in a mason jar.
